Commit 37d272e2 authored by Gilles MARCKMANN's avatar Gilles MARCKMANN

add/moddified header comments relative to licensing.

DamageBandDyn is under GNU GPL license.
parent bf9d6771
THE CONTRIBUTORS OF eXlibris/DamageBandDyn ARE:
Nicolas MOES
Kevin MOREAU,
/* /*
This source code is subject to non-permissive licence, This file is a part of eXlibris C++ Library
see the DamageBandDyn/LICENSE file for conditions. under the GNU General Public License:
See the LICENSE.md files for terms and
conditions.
*/ */
// DamageBandDyn // DamageBandDyn
#include "Algorithm.h" #include "Algorithm.h"
#include "Contact.h" #include "Contact.h"
......
/* /*
This source code is subject to non-permissive licence, This file is a part of eXlibris C++ Library
see the DamageBandDyn/LICENSE file for conditions. under the GNU General Public License:
See the LICENSE.md files for terms and
conditions.
*/ */
#ifndef _Algorithm_h #ifndef _Algorithm_h
#define _Algorithm_h #define _Algorithm_h
// DamageBandDyn // DamageBandDyn
......
/* /*
This source code is subject to non-permissive licence, This file is a part of eXlibris C++ Library
see the DamageBandDyn/LICENSE file for conditions. under the GNU General Public License:
See the LICENSE.md files for terms and
conditions.
*/ */
#ifndef _Algorithm_imp_h #ifndef _Algorithm_imp_h
#define _Algorithm_imp_h #define _Algorithm_imp_h
#include <iostream> #include <iostream>
......
/* /*
This source code is subject to non-permissive licence, This file is a part of eXlibris C++ Library
see the DamageBandDyn/LICENSE file for conditions. under the GNU General Public License:
See the LICENSE.md files for terms and
conditions.
*/ */
// DamageBandDyn // DamageBandDyn
#include "AsymmetricBehaviour.h" #include "AsymmetricBehaviour.h"
#include "refactoring.h" #include "refactoring.h"
......
/* /*
This source code is subject to non-permissive licence, This file is a part of eXlibris C++ Library
see the DamageBandDyn/LICENSE file for conditions. under the GNU General Public License:
See the LICENSE.md files for terms and
conditions.
*/ */
#ifndef _AsymmetricBehaviour_h #ifndef _AsymmetricBehaviour_h
#define _AsymmetricBehaviour_h #define _AsymmetricBehaviour_h
// DamageBandDyn // DamageBandDyn
......
/* /*
This source code is subject to non-permissive licence, This file is a part of eXlibris C++ Library
see the DamageBandDyn/LICENSE file for conditions. under the GNU General Public License:
See the LICENSE.md files for terms and
conditions.
*/ */
#ifndef AsymmetricBehaviour_imp_h_ #ifndef AsymmetricBehaviour_imp_h_
#define AsymmetricBehaviour_imp_h_ #define AsymmetricBehaviour_imp_h_
......
/* /*
This source code is subject to non-permissive licence, This file is a part of eXlibris C++ Library
see the DamageBandDyn/LICENSE file for conditions. under the GNU General Public License:
See the LICENSE.md files for terms and
conditions.
*/ */
#include "CFL.h" #include "CFL.h"
double ComputeMinInsideRadius::operator()(double val, AOMD::mEntity* e) const double ComputeMinInsideRadius::operator()(double val, AOMD::mEntity* e) const
......
/* /*
This source code is subject to non-permissive licence, This file is a part of eXlibris C++ Library
see the DamageBandDyn/LICENSE file for conditions. under the GNU General Public License:
See the LICENSE.md files for terms and
conditions.
*/ */
#ifndef _CFL_h #ifndef _CFL_h
#define _CFL_h #define _CFL_h
// SolverInterface // SolverInterface
......
/* /*
This source code is subject to non-permissive licence, This file is a part of eXlibris C++ Library
see the DamageBandDyn/LICENSE file for conditions. under the GNU General Public License:
See the LICENSE.md files for terms and
conditions.
*/ */
#ifndef _CentralDifferenceTimeIntegrationScheme_h #ifndef _CentralDifferenceTimeIntegrationScheme_h
#define _CentralDifferenceTimeIntegrationScheme_h #define _CentralDifferenceTimeIntegrationScheme_h
// DamageBandDyn // DamageBandDyn
......
/* /*
This source code is subject to non-permissive licence, This file is a part of eXlibris C++ Library
see the DamageBandDyn/LICENSE file for conditions. under the GNU General Public License:
See the LICENSE.md files for terms and
conditions.
*/ */
#ifndef _CentralDifferenceTimeIntegrationScheme_imp_h_ #ifndef _CentralDifferenceTimeIntegrationScheme_imp_h_
#define _CentralDifferenceTimeIntegrationScheme_imp_h_ #define _CentralDifferenceTimeIntegrationScheme_imp_h_
// DamageBandDyn // DamageBandDyn
......
/* /*
This source code is subject to non-permissive licence, This file is a part of eXlibris C++ Library
see the DamageBandDyn/LICENSE file for conditions. under the GNU General Public License:
See the LICENSE.md files for terms and
conditions.
*/ */
// DamageBandDyn // DamageBandDyn
#include "CommandOnGeomElem.h" #include "CommandOnGeomElem.h"
// Xfem // Xfem
......
/* /*
This source code is subject to non-permissive licence, This file is a part of eXlibris C++ Library
see the DamageBandDyn/LICENSE file for conditions. under the GNU General Public License:
See the LICENSE.md files for terms and
conditions.
*/ */
#ifndef _CommandOnGeomElem_h #ifndef _CommandOnGeomElem_h
#define _CommandOnGeomElem_h #define _CommandOnGeomElem_h
// Xfem // Xfem
......
/* /*
This source code is subject to non-permissive licence, This file is a part of eXlibris C++ Library
see the DamageBandDyn/LICENSE file for conditions. under the GNU General Public License:
See the LICENSE.md files for terms and
conditions.
*/ */
#include "Contact.h" #include "Contact.h"
// Xfem // Xfem
#include "xSimpleGeometry.h" #include "xSimpleGeometry.h"
......
/* /*
This source code is subject to non-permissive licence, This file is a part of eXlibris C++ Library
see the DamageBandDyn/LICENSE file for conditions. under the GNU General Public License:
See the LICENSE.md files for terms and
conditions.
*/ */
#ifndef _Contact_h_ #ifndef _Contact_h_
#define _Contact_h_ #define _Contact_h_
// Xfem // Xfem
......
/* /*
This source code is subject to non-permissive licence, This file is a part of eXlibris C++ Library
see the DamageBandDyn/LICENSE file for conditions. under the GNU General Public License:
See the LICENSE.md files for terms and
conditions.
*/ */
#ifndef _DamagedDeviatorBehaviour_h #ifndef _DamagedDeviatorBehaviour_h
#define _DamagedDeviatorBehaviour_h #define _DamagedDeviatorBehaviour_h
// DamageBandDyn // DamageBandDyn
......
/* /*
This source code is subject to non-permissive licence, This file is a part of eXlibris C++ Library
see the DamageBandDyn/LICENSE file for conditions. under the GNU General Public License:
See the LICENSE.md files for terms and
conditions.
*/ */
#ifndef _DamagedDeviatorBehaviour_imp_h_ #ifndef _DamagedDeviatorBehaviour_imp_h_
#define _DamagedDeviatorBehaviour_imp_h_ #define _DamagedDeviatorBehaviour_imp_h_
......
/* /*
This source code is subject to non-permissive licence, This file is a part of eXlibris C++ Library
see the DamageBandDyn/LICENSE file for conditions. under the GNU General Public License:
See the LICENSE.md files for terms and
conditions.
*/ */
#ifndef _ENTITY_FILTER_H #ifndef _ENTITY_FILTER_H
#define _ENTITY_FILTER_H #define _ENTITY_FILTER_H
// Xfem // Xfem
......
/* /*
This source code is subject to non-permissive licence, This file is a part of eXlibris C++ Library
see the DamageBandDyn/LICENSE file for conditions. under the GNU General Public License:
See the LICENSE.md files for terms and
conditions.
*/ */
#ifndef _EntityToEntity_h_ #ifndef _EntityToEntity_h_
#define _EntityToEntity_h_ #define _EntityToEntity_h_
// Xfem // Xfem
......
/* /*
This source code is subject to non-permissive licence, This file is a part of eXlibris C++ Library
see the DamageBandDyn/LICENSE file for conditions. under the GNU General Public License:
See the LICENSE.md files for terms and
conditions.
*/ */
// DamageBandDyn // DamageBandDyn
#include "Eval.h" #include "Eval.h"
......
/* /*
This source code is subject to non-permissive licence, This file is a part of eXlibris C++ Library
see the DamageBandDyn/LICENSE file for conditions. under the GNU General Public License:
See the LICENSE.md files for terms and
conditions.
*/ */
#ifndef _Eval_h #ifndef _Eval_h
#define _Eval_h #define _Eval_h
// DamageBandDyn // DamageBandDyn
......
/* /*
This source code is subject to non-permissive licence, This file is a part of eXlibris C++ Library
see the DamageBandDyn/LICENSE file for conditions. under the GNU General Public License:
See the LICENSE.md files for terms and
conditions.
*/ */
// DamageBandDyn // DamageBandDyn
#include "Export.h" #include "Export.h"
#include "Restore.h" #include "Restore.h"
......
/* /*
This source code is subject to non-permissive licence, This file is a part of eXlibris C++ Library
see the DamageBandDyn/LICENSE file for conditions. under the GNU General Public License:
See the LICENSE.md files for terms and
conditions.
*/ */
#ifndef _Export_h #ifndef _Export_h
#define _Export_h #define _Export_h
// DamageBandDyn // DamageBandDyn
......
/* /*
This source code is subject to non-permissive licence, This file is a part of eXlibris C++ Library
see the DamageBandDyn/LICENSE file for conditions. under the GNU General Public License:
See the LICENSE.md files for terms and
conditions.
*/ */
#ifndef _Formulation_h_ #ifndef _Formulation_h_
#define _Formulation_h_ #define _Formulation_h_
// DamageBandDyn // DamageBandDyn
......
/* /*
This source code is subject to non-permissive licence, This file is a part of eXlibris C++ Library
see the DamageBandDyn/LICENSE file for conditions. under the GNU General Public License:
See the LICENSE.md files for terms and
conditions.
*/ */
// DamageBandDyn // DamageBandDyn
#include "Geom.h" #include "Geom.h"
// Xfem // Xfem
......
/* /*
This source code is subject to non-permissive licence, This file is a part of eXlibris C++ Library
see the DamageBandDyn/LICENSE file for conditions. under the GNU General Public License:
See the LICENSE.md files for terms and
conditions.
*/ */
#ifndef _Geom_h_ #ifndef _Geom_h_
#define _Geom_h_ #define _Geom_h_
#include <map> #include <map>
......
/* /*
This source code is subject to non-permissive licence, This file is a part of eXlibris C++ Library
see the DamageBandDyn/LICENSE file for conditions. under the GNU General Public License:
See the LICENSE.md files for terms and
conditions.
*/ */
#ifndef _GeomTrait_h_ #ifndef _GeomTrait_h_
#define _GeomTrait_h_ #define _GeomTrait_h_
// std // std
......
/* /*
This source code is subject to non-permissive licence, This file is a part of eXlibris C++ Library
see the DamageBandDyn/LICENSE file for conditions. under the GNU General Public License:
See the LICENSE.md files for terms and
conditions.
*/ */
#ifndef _Geom_imp_h_ #ifndef _Geom_imp_h_
#define _Geom_imp_h_ #define _Geom_imp_h_
......
/* /*
This source code is subject to non-permissive licence, This file is a part of eXlibris C++ Library
see the DamageBandDyn/LICENSE file for conditions. under the GNU General Public License:
See the LICENSE.md files for terms and
conditions.
*/ */
// DamageBandDyn // DamageBandDyn
#include "IncrementallyObjectiveTimeIntegration.h" #include "IncrementallyObjectiveTimeIntegration.h"
#include "Restore.h" #include "Restore.h"
......
/* /*
This source code is subject to non-permissive licence, This file is a part of eXlibris C++ Library
see the DamageBandDyn/LICENSE file for conditions. under the GNU General Public License:
See the LICENSE.md files for terms and
conditions.
*/ */
#ifndef _IncrementallyObjectiveTimeIntegration_h_ #ifndef _IncrementallyObjectiveTimeIntegration_h_
#define _IncrementallyObjectiveTimeIntegration_h_ #define _IncrementallyObjectiveTimeIntegration_h_
// Xfem // Xfem
......
/* /*
This source code is subject to non-permissive licence, This file is a part of eXlibris C++ Library
see the DamageBandDyn/LICENSE file for conditions. under the GNU General Public License:
See the LICENSE.md files for terms and
conditions.
*/ */
// DamageBandDyn // DamageBandDyn
#include "InputManager.h" #include "InputManager.h"
#include "tools.h" #include "tools.h"
......
/* /*
This source code is subject to non-permissive licence, This file is a part of eXlibris C++ Library
see the DamageBandDyn/LICENSE file for conditions. under the GNU General Public License:
See the LICENSE.md files for terms and
conditions.
*/ */
#ifndef _InputManager_h #ifndef _InputManager_h
#define _InputManager_h #define _InputManager_h
#include <string> #include <string>
......
/* /*
This source code is subject to non-permissive licence, This file is a part of eXlibris C++ Library
see the DamageBandDyn/LICENSE file for conditions. under the GNU General Public License:
See the LICENSE.md files for terms and
conditions.
*/ */
#ifndef _IsotropicBehaviour_h #ifndef _IsotropicBehaviour_h
#define _IsotropicBehaviour_h #define _IsotropicBehaviour_h
// DamageBandDyn // DamageBandDyn
......
/* /*
This source code is subject to non-permissive licence, This file is a part of eXlibris C++ Library
see the DamageBandDyn/LICENSE file for conditions. under the GNU General Public License:
See the LICENSE.md files for terms and
conditions.
*/ */
// DamageBandDyn // DamageBandDyn
#include "Kinematic.h" #include "Kinematic.h"
// xTLS // xTLS
......
/* /*
This source code is subject to non-permissive licence, This file is a part of eXlibris C++ Library
see the DamageBandDyn/LICENSE file for conditions. under the GNU General Public License:
See the LICENSE.md files for terms and
conditions.
*/ */
#ifndef _Kinematic_h_ #ifndef _Kinematic_h_
#define _Kinematic_h_ #define _Kinematic_h_
// DamageBandDyn // DamageBandDyn
......
/* /*
This source code is subject to non-permissive licence, This file is a part of eXlibris C++ Library
see the DamageBandDyn/LICENSE file for conditions. under the GNU General Public License:
See the LICENSE.md files for terms and
conditions.
*/ */
/// DamageBandDyn /// DamageBandDyn
#include "Algorithm.h" #include "Algorithm.h"
#include "LevelSetOperators.h" #include "LevelSetOperators.h"
......
/* /*
This source code is subject to non-permissive licence, This file is a part of eXlibris C++ Library
see the DamageBandDyn/LICENSE file for conditions. under the GNU General Public License:
See the LICENSE.md files for terms and
conditions.
*/ */
#ifndef _LevelSetOperators_h #ifndef _LevelSetOperators_h
#define _LevelSetOperators_h #define _LevelSetOperators_h
// xTLS // xTLS
......
/* /*
This source code is subject to non-permissive licence, This file is a part of eXlibris C++ Library
see the DamageBandDyn/LICENSE file for conditions. under the GNU General Public License:
See the LICENSE.md files for terms and
conditions.
*/ */
#ifndef _MatlibPlasticityBehaviour_h_ #ifndef _MatlibPlasticityBehaviour_h_
#define _MatlibPlasticityBehaviour_h_ #define _MatlibPlasticityBehaviour_h_
// DamageBandDyn // DamageBandDyn
......
/* /*
This source code is subject to non-permissive licence, This file is a part of eXlibris C++ Library
see the DamageBandDyn/LICENSE file for conditions. under the GNU General Public License:
See the LICENSE.md files for terms and
conditions.
*/ */
// DamageBandDyn // DamageBandDyn
#include "MeshDisplacement.h" #include "MeshDisplacement.h"
// Xfem // Xfem
......
/* /*
This source code is subject to non-permissive licence, This file is a part of eXlibris C++ Library
see the DamageBandDyn/LICENSE file for conditions. under the GNU General Public License:
See the LICENSE.md files for terms and
conditions.
*/ */
#ifndef _MeshDisplacement_h #ifndef _MeshDisplacement_h
#define _MeshDisplacement_h #define _MeshDisplacement_h
// Xfem // Xfem
......
/* /*
This source code is subject to non-permissive licence, This file is a part of eXlibris C++ Library
see the DamageBandDyn/LICENSE file for conditions. under the GNU General Public License:
See the LICENSE.md files for terms and
conditions.
*/ */
// void ProjectLevelSetOnFineGrid(const xLevelSet& level_set, const xMesh* bnd_mesh, // void ProjectLevelSetOnFineGrid(const xLevelSet& level_set, const xMesh* bnd_mesh,
// xEntityFilter matter_support, xEntityFilter void_support, // xEntityFilter matter_support, xEntityFilter void_support,
// xEntityFilter matter_bnd, xEntityFilter filter, // xEntityFilter matter_bnd, xEntityFilter filter,
......
/* /*
This source code is subject to non-permissive licence, This file is a part of eXlibris C++ Library
see the DamageBandDyn/LICENSE file for conditions. under the GNU General Public License:
See the LICENSE.md files for terms and